Serious allergic reactions can also occasionally occur, causing … WebJul 14, 2024 · How to treat a wasp sting 1. Wash the affected site thoroughly with soap and water. 2. Apply ice to the sting area to decrease swelling and pain (leave it on for 10 minutes, then remove it for 10 minutes, over the course of 30 minutes to an hour). 3. Raise the body part where the sting is located to help reduce swelling. 4.

Webremove the sting or tick if it's still in the skin wash the affected area with soap and water apply a cold compress (such as a flannel or cloth cooled with cold water) or an ice pack to any swelling for at least 10 minutes raise or elevate the affected area if possible, as this can help reduce swelling WebMar 18, 2024 · Remove any stingers. Gently wash the area with soap and water. Apply a cloth dampened with cold water or filled with ice to the area of the bite or sting for 10 to 20 minutes. This helps reduce pain and swelling. If the injury is on an arm or leg, raise it.
